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7846141748 770164230 4795 348079 502997951
3619483883 006559 65555
3619483883 006559 65555
9863 340886 1366 03956
All about undefined
Interested in learning more?
3619483883 006559 65555
9863 340886 1366 03956
See more
1428327 5872922113 0767894
0128966 9804 25
See more
55879416 2135855098
477423007 91303314 75 81719255 5954154
See more